However I'd like to know if it is possible to create a production JS web application in 2020 that doesn't use a bundler like webpack or Parcel and uses ES2015 Modules? A caveat being that a source-to-source compiler like Babel could still be used provided it preserves ES2015 Modules syntax. I'm not saying I would like to do this but for the sake of argument, what would be the downsides?
Client-side code does not have to be bundled when run in a modern browser, but if you're going to design your code into tons of small modules (for the sake of development efficiency and reuse), then it will be very inefficient to load if you don't use a bundler that can reduce the number of separate files that need to be loaded.
A bundler will be desirable if you design your client JS files for best modular development and thus don't design your client JS files for efficient delivery as the bundler can bundle things together for efficient delivery in a build process.

It is certainly possible to design client-side JS files from the beginning for efficient client-side delivery and not use a bundler (like we used to do), but you will not be able to also design the layout of the files for modular development. A bundler allows you achieve both goals which is probably why they are so popular.
